Come brave the DC ADIZ and fly into Leesburg (KJYO) for our open house on Saturday, August 30th.

The EAA Aluminum Overcast will be here. We'll have FAA safety seminars, and are working on a full stack of events.

If you've got a cool homebuilt, or warbird, we'd love to have you visit and join our static displays.
